Judgment text excerpt

The Supreme Court upheld the High Court's dismissal of the writ petition challenging the Governor's order under Article 161 of the Constitution regarding remission of sentences for certain categories of prisoners. The Court clarified that the Governor's discretion in granting remission is subject to the conditions specified in the Government order, which excludes prisoners convicted of serious offenses such as those under Section 302 IPC and crimes against women. The Court affirmed the legality of the Government order and the conditions imposed therein, thereby rejecting the appellant's claim for remission.
